
PLANTATION, FL-Beech Street Capital has provided $16.3 million in refinancing loan for the Jacaranda Village apartment community in Plantation. Scully Company, a Beech Street client, requested the lender to pay off tax exempt bonds with low fixed-rate debt.
The borrower received the Fannie Mae conventional loan for the 296-unit complex at 461 NW 87th Road. The fixed-rate, seven-year loan will help the borrower to refinance the property.
